A vesicointestinal fistula (or intestinovesical fistula) is a form of fistula between the bladder and the bowel. A fistula involving the bladder can have one of many specific names, describing the specific location of its outlet: Bladder and intestine: "vesicoenteric", "enterovesical", or "vesicointestinal". Bladder and colon: "vesicocolic" or "colovesical". Bladder and rectum: "vesicorectal" or "rectovesical".
Vesico-intestinal fistulae were observed in 14 patients within a period of 10 years (vesico-colonic: ten; vesico-rectal: two; vesico-ileal and vesico-rectal-ileal: one each). The causes were diverticulitis in five, carcinoma of the sigmoid in two, radiation damage after prostatic or cervical carcinoma in two, and Crohn's disease, abscess of Douglas's pouch after perforated appendicitis, ileal carcinoma, sarcoma of the pelvis, and ovarian carcinoma, one each. In the neoplastic fistulae the underlying carcinoma could not be radically operated on: colostomy or colostomy with palliative resection was performed. In four of these the fistulae then closed, once it remained open. One woman with a vesicorectal fistula due to ovarian carcinoma died of tumor cachexia 16 days after a colostomy had been made. Diagnosis and treatment of vesico-intestinal fistula. MedLine Citation: PMID: 2911876 Owner: NLM Status: MEDLINE. ct: In a retrospective study of 28 patients with vesico-intestinal fistula, the maximal diagnostic latency was eight years. The most common causes were diverticulitis (16 patients) and carcinoma of the colon (4 patients). Recurrent urinary tract infections with pneumaturia and/or faecaluria were found in 23 patients. The diagnosis was most accurately confirmed by cystoscopy and barium enema which showed evidence of a fistula in 20 patients.

Vesicovaginal fistula (VVF) is a subtype of female urogenital fistula (UGF). Vesicovaginal fistula, or VVF, is an abnormal fistulous tract extending between the bladder (vesica) and the vagina that allows the continuous involuntary discharge of urine into the vaginal vault. In addition to the medical sequela from these fistulas, they often have a profound effect on the patient's emotional well-being.
